在Spring Framework里的spring-core核心包里面,有个org.springframework.util里面有不少非常实用的工具类。 该工具包里面的工具类虽然是被定义在Spring下面的,但是由于Spring框架目前几乎成了JavaEE实际的标准了,因此我们直接使用也是无妨的,很多时候能够大大的提高我们的生产力。本文主要介绍一些个人认为还非常实用的工具...
<beans xmlns="http://www.springframework.org/schema/beans"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:context="http://www.springframework.org/schema/context" xsi:schemaLocation="http://www.springframework.org/schema/beans http://www.springframework.org/schema/beans/spring-be...
SpringFramework详解 一、什么是Spring Framework Spring Framework 为基于 Java 的现代企业应用程序提供了一个全面的编程和配置模型。它是一个开源框架,集成了IOC、DI与AOP容器技术的框架。 Spring 是应用程序级别的基础支持,专注于企业应用程序的“管道”,因此团队可以只关心应用程序的业务逻辑,而无需关注与特定部署环境...
Spring Framework是一个轻量级的框架,它不依赖于任何第三方库或容器,可以很容易地集成到Java应用程序中。 面向对象 Spring Framework是一个面向对象的框架,它提供了一系列的对象和接口,用于构建Java应用程序。 松耦合 Spring Framework采用了松耦合的设计,它将组件之间的依赖关系通过配置文件或注解来管理,使得组件之间的...
Spring 整合 JavaWeb 可以实现由Spring来控制事务和管理数据库,Spring容器可以管理Java Bean,有助于降低代码耦合。
Spring Framework:Java平台下的全栈解决方案 > ### 摘要 > Spring Framework 是一个广泛使用的开源Java平台,它通过提供全面的基础设施支持,使得开发包括Web、安全性、数据访问、消息传递、测试和更多场景在内的Java应用程序变得更加容易。从最初的简单依赖注入和面向切面编程框架,Spring 已经发展成为一个庞大的生态系统...
### 摘要 Spring Framework是一款基于Java的开源应用程序开发框架,它提供了全面的全功能栈支持,适用于Java及Java EE应用开发。该框架遵循Apache许可证发布,这意味着开发者可以自由地使用、修改和分发Spring Framework的代码。值得一提的是,Spring Framework还拥有一个针对.NET平台的移植版本,进一步扩大了其适用范围。 #...
Spring Framework 中 IoC 的实现原理主要包括以下几个步骤: 配置:首先,开发者需要在 XML 文件或 Java 配置类中定义应用程序中的对象(称为 Bean)及其依赖关系。这些配置信息将被 Spring 容器读取并解析。 初始化:当应用程序启动时,Spring 容器会根据配置信息创建 Bean 实例,并根据配置的依赖关系,将依赖对象注入到需...
springframework java 版本 目录 1.7. Bean定义继承 1.8. 容器的扩展点 1.8.1.使用BeanPostProcessor定制bean 1.8.2. 使用BeanFactoryPostProcessor自定义配置元数据 1.8.3. 使用 FactoryBean 自定义实例化逻辑 1.7. Bean定义继承 bean定义可以包含很多配置信息,包括构造函数参数、属性值和容器特定的信息,例如初始化...
“Spring”一词在不同的上下文中有不同的含义,它可以用来引用Spring Framework项目本身,这是它开始的地方,随着时间的推移,其他Spring项目已经构建在Spring Framework之上,大多数情况下,当人们说“Spring”,他们指的是整个家庭的项目,这个参考文档主要关注基础:Spring Framework本身。